<title>Academic/Faculty: Press Release - Breaking a Research Record</title>
<link>http://www.musc.edu/broadcast/show/16201</link>
<description>Broadcast date: 2008-08-07&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;Colleagues -
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;I am writing to convey great news to the MUSC community.
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;As you know, the research programs at MUSC have undergone tremendous growth
&lt;br/&gt;over the last 10 years.
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;For FY08 ending June 30th 2008,  our records indicate that we have achieved
&lt;br/&gt;a new MUSC record for extramural research funding.
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;We have topped the $200M mark for total research funding and have topped the $100M mark for funding from the National Institutes of Health! (See attached Press Release that will go out later today)
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;Total extramural funding increased from $193M in FY07 to $202M for FY08.
&lt;br/&gt;NIH funding increased from $93M in FY07 to $101M in FY08.
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;This is a significant and remarkable achievement!
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;I believe that the sustained increase in NIH funding over the last three years is particularly noteworthy as it occurs in the face of a flat or declining federal budget for research and is a real solid indicator of the quality of our programs.
&lt;br/&gt;

<title>Announcements/Newsletters - University: Faculty Members Designated as Distinguished University Professors</title>
<link>http://www.musc.edu/broadcast/show/16277</link>
<description>Broadcast date: 2008-08-21&lt;br/&gt;Link: http://people.musc.edu/~stonej/SHARED/DUPannounce.pdf&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;The Office of the Provost is pleased to inform you that the MUSC Board of Trustees approved the designation of Distinguished University Professor for two of our faculty members at their meeting on August 8.  
&lt;br/&gt;
&lt;br/&gt;Gail W. Stuart, Ph.D. and John (Jack) R. Feussner, M.D., M.P.H., join fewer than thirty individuals who have been chosen to receive this designation during the history of our university.  Individuals chosen for the designation of Distinguished University Professor are internationally recognized as leaders in their chosen academic and scholarly fields.  Additionally, those individuals have contributed in substantial ways to the betterment of our institution through activities outside of their primary field of scholarship, and over a sustained period of time.

<title>NEWS ALERT: Samuel S. Spicer, M.D., Professor Emeritus</title>
<link>http://www.musc.edu/broadcast/show/16269</link>
<description>Broadcast date: 2008-08-19&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;Samuel S. Spicer, M.D., Professor Emeritus, and a faculty member with more than 40 years devoted service to MUSC and the Department of Pathology and Laboratory Medicine, passed away August 18. He was 94.
